WATCH: Beto O’Rourke CONFRONTED at town hall about stingy charitable donations

It turns out that Beto O’Rourke really isn’t that much of a charitable guy.

His tax returns reveal that he only gave 0.3% of his income to charity in 2017:

FOX NEWS – The filings show the couple had given $1,166 to charity in 2017 despite having a combined income of $370,412, which calculates to roughly one-third of 1 percent of their income. According to The Washington Post’s James Hohmann, that places O’Rourke last among the 2020 candidates competing in the Democratic primaries.
